The NetSuite ERP Module Guide: What You Really Need—and What to Avoid
NetSuite’s modular ERP system is one of its greatest strengths—but it’s also one of the easiest places for businesses to overspend.
13 min read
Admin : Mar 19, 2025 5:56:24 PM
Enterprise Resource Planning (ERP) systems are essential for businesses aiming to integrate their financial, operational, inventory, and customer relationship management processes within a single, streamlined environment. With the global ERP market reaching $48 billion in 2022 and expected to double by 2032, more businesses are investing in platforms that integrate financials, operations, and customer management into one seamless system.
NetSuite and Microsoft Dynamics 365 are two of the most widely used ERP solutions, but they take different approaches. NetSuite offers a fully cloud-based, all-in-one system designed for growing and global businesses, while Dynamics 365 provides a modular, highly customizable solution that integrates tightly with Microsoft products. This guide will compare these platforms comprehensively, providing insights into real-world applications to help businesses align their ERP selection with long-term strategic objectives.
NetSuite is widely recognized as one of the first cloud-native ERP solutions, designed from the ground up to support modern business needs without requiring extensive on-premises infrastructure. Originally developed as an accounting software platform, NetSuite has since expanded into a robust ERP solution that includes financial management, CRM, e-commerce, and business intelligence. Its comprehensive, all-in-one approach eliminates the need for multiple disconnected systems, making it a highly efficient option for growing businesses.
NetSuite offers a broad range of features designed to improve business operations, enhance financial oversight, and drive efficiency.
Real-Time Insights: One of NetSuite’s most valuable strengths is its ability to provide real-time visibility into financial and operational data. Instant access to key performance metrics enables managers to make proactive decisions. For example, if a retailer notices a sudden surge in demand for a product in a specific region, they can quickly adjust inventory allocation or logistics strategies to meet the increased demand.
Multi-Currency & Global Support: As businesses expand internationally, handling multiple currencies and tax regulations can become complex. NetSuite automates currency conversions, tax compliance, and international financial consolidation through its OneWorld module. This module is essential for businesses managing multiple subsidiaries or operating internationally, as it provides advanced capabilities for global financial management.
Unified Dashboard: Instead of relying on multiple software platforms to track finances, sales, and inventory, NetSuite provides a single dashboard that consolidates all business functions. This integrated view ensures that leadership teams have quick access to critical business insights without toggling between different applications.
NetSuite is a highly adaptable platform that serves a diverse range of businesses, from small startups to large multinational enterprises.
Small to Mid-Market Firms: Many mid-sized businesses, particularly in service industries, distribution, and e-commerce, benefit from NetSuite’s ability to unify multiple business processes into a single system. These firms reduce inefficiencies and enhance operational visibility by consolidating fragmented software applications.
Larger Enterprises: Large businesses with multiple subsidiaries or international operations choose NetSuite for its scalability and ability to support multi-entity financial management. The platform’s robust reporting and compliance tools are well-suited for organizations dealing with complex regulatory environments.
NetSuite’s cloud-based, multi-tenant architecture provides several advantages over traditional on-premises ERP systems.
Quick Set-Up: Since NetSuite is cloud-based, companies don’t need to invest in expensive on-premises hardware or wait for lengthy infrastructure installations. This leads to faster deployment times and reduced disruptions to business operations.
Automatic Upgrades: Unlike legacy ERP systems that require manual software updates, NetSuite continuously rolls out improvements, security patches, and compliance updates. This ensures that businesses always use the latest technology without additional IT burden.
Vendor-Managed Infrastructure: NetSuite is managed by Oracle, meaning companies don’t have to maintain their own servers or worry about system performance and security. IT teams can focus on strategic initiatives rather than routine system maintenance.
Consideration: While NetSuite’s automatic updates are beneficial, companies with extensive customizations may need to test and adjust configurations when new releases are deployed to ensure compatibility.
Microsoft Dynamics 365 is a modular suite of ERP and CRM applications that allows businesses to choose the functionalities they need while maintaining flexibility for future expansion. Instead of a single, unified platform, Dynamics 365 consists of individual modules—such as Dynamics 365 Finance, Dynamics 365 Sales, and Dynamics 365 Supply Chain Management—that can be implemented independently or integrated as needed.
Modular Architecture: One of the key differentiators of Dynamics 365 is its modular structure. Businesses can implement only the applications they require, such as finance, sales, or customer service, and later add new modules as their needs evolve. This flexibility allows organizations to start small and scale efficiently.
Integration with Microsoft Products: Since Dynamics 365 is developed by Microsoft, it integrates seamlessly with Office 365, Power BI, Azure, and Teams. For example, sales teams can pull ERP data into Excel for analysis, while executives can use Power BI to visualize business performance in real-time.
Customizable Modules: Dynamics 365 allows businesses to tailor functionalities to fit their specific operational needs. Organizations that require industry-specific workflows or custom automation can leverage Microsoft’s Power Platform to develop no-code or low-code applications that align with their business processes.
Microsoft Dynamics 365 serves a broad spectrum of industries and company sizes, making it a highly versatile ERP choice.
Small to Large Enterprises: Due to its modular nature, Dynamics 365 is suitable for businesses of all sizes. Small companies can start with a single module, while larger enterprises can integrate multiple applications for a full-suite ERP experience.
Industry Agnostic: Dynamics 365 is widely used in manufacturing, finance, retail, healthcare, and other industries. Businesses that need industry-specific capabilities—such as advanced cost accounting for manufacturing or AI-driven customer insights for retail—can leverage specialized modules tailored to their sector.
Microsoft Dynamics 365 provides flexibility in how businesses deploy their ERP system: Cloud Deployment, On-Premises Deployment, and Hybrid Deployment. However, not all modules support all deployment types. For example, Microsoft Dynamics 365 Business Central is primarily cloud-based with limited on-premises capabilities. Here's a quick look about the other deployment options:
Cloud Deployment: The cloud-based version reduces IT maintenance and enables automatic updates, similar to NetSuite. It’s ideal for businesses looking to minimize infrastructure costs.
On-Premises Deployment: For organizations that require full control over their data and systems—particularly those in regulated industries like finance or healthcare—Dynamics 365 offers an on-premises option.
Hybrid Deployment: Some companies opt for a hybrid approach, using cloud-based applications for certain functions while maintaining on-premises infrastructure for sensitive data or legacy system integration.
Consideration: Companies transitioning from older Microsoft ERP solutions like Dynamics AX, NAV, or GP may find it easier to migrate to Dynamics 365, as Microsoft has built-in tools to facilitate the transition.
To make an informed decision, it helps to compare specific areas like cost, user experience, scalability, and how each system handles expansions or custom code.
Aspect | NetSuite | Microsoft Dynamics 365 |
---|---|---|
Licensing Model |
Subscription-based with add-on modules |
Offers subscription and perpetual license options |
Cost Predictability |
Generally predictable subscription fees |
Varies based on the mix of modules and deployment type |
Budget Considerations |
May become complex as additional modules are added |
Flexible, but extra modules can increase overall costs |
Insight: If you anticipate scaling your ERP over time, NetSuite’s predictable subscription model may simplify budgeting. However, businesses should consider potential additional costs for customizations, integrations, and user licenses as they scale. Dynamics 365’s modular pricing can offer more flexibility—though costs may become harder to track as additional modules are introduced.
A growing company needs an ERP system that can expand in both size and complexity without causing operational disruptions. NetSuite and Dynamics 365 offer scalability, but they differ in handling customizations and system expansions.
Factor | NetSuite | Microsoft Dynamics 365 |
---|---|---|
Unified Codebase / Modular Design | NetSuite’s single codebase ensures uniform expansion across modules; new features are available to all users immediately. | Dynamics 365’s modular design allows individual modules to be scaled independently. |
Global Integration | Seamless addition of new business units or regional entities with minimal technical overhead. | Targeted customizations at the module level, enabling tailored enhancements. |
Customization Approach | Customization is generally achieved through configuration, reducing the need for extensive coding. | Leverages Microsoft’s Power Platform for granular, module-specific customizations. |
Consideration: If your company operates in multiple countries, NetSuite’s global capabilities offer a more turnkey solution. However, if you require highly tailored workflows and deep integration with Microsoft applications, Dynamics 365’s modular customization options may provide better alignment with your business needs.
User experience can determine whether employees adapt quickly or struggle to make sense of new procedures. Both NetSuite and Microsoft Dynamics 365 aim to reduce confusion, but they do so in distinct ways.
Aspect | NetSuite | Microsoft Dynamics 365 |
---|---|---|
Dashboard | Single, unified dashboard aggregating data from all modules. | Familiar interface consistent with Office 365, though each module may have a different layout. |
Personalization | Role-based views provide customized information relevant to each user. | Customizable dashboards and module-specific layouts offer flexibility but may require adaptation. |
Consistency | Consistent user experience across functions due to a unified system. | Modular design may lead to variations in user experience between modules. |
Takeaway: If your organization values consistency across all functions, NetSuite’s unified experience may be preferable. However, companies already using Microsoft products may find Dynamics 365’s familiar interface easier to adopt, especially with its Office 365 integration.
ERP systems don’t operate in isolation—they must connect with other business tools such as e-commerce platforms, analytics solutions, and automation tools. Here’s how NetSuite and Dynamics 365 compare in terms of integration.
Integration Aspect | NetSuite | Microsoft Dynamics 365 |
---|---|---|
Core Integration | NetSuite SuiteCloud Platform uses REST/SOAP APIs and SuiteScript for advanced logic or bridging third-party solutions. | Deep alignment with Office 365 and Azure; can incorporate legacy solutions like Dynamics NAV or Dynamics AX into the newer cloud modules. |
E-commerce Connectors | NetSuite also offers direct connections with Shopify, Magento, and other platforms for real-time order syncing. | Dynamics 365 can integrate with Microsoft’s own storefront solutions or external e-commerce via the Power Platform or custom APIs. |
Partner Ecosystem | Large network of NetSuite-specific partners who build add-ons or handle advanced deployments, especially valuable for vertical industries. | Microsoft also has an extensive partner network, including integrators who help unify on-premises solutions (like Microsoft Dynamics GP). |
Automation Tools | Configuration-based scripts or third-party solutions can automate recurring tasks (e.g., batch invoicing). | Dynamics 365 also taps into Power Automate (Flow) for no-code workflows that can tie multiple modules or external apps together. |
Key Insight: If your business relies heavily on Microsoft tools, Dynamics 365’s deep integration with Office 365 and Azure is a major advantage. However, if you need robust e-commerce and inventory management integrations, NetSuite’s SuiteCommerce and third-party connectors may offer a more seamless experience.
Implementing an ERP is only the beginning—ongoing support and maintenance are crucial for long-term success. Here’s how NetSuite and Dynamics 365 handle updates, maintenance, and technical support.
Aspect | NetSuite | Microsoft Dynamics 365 |
---|---|---|
Update Process | Automatic updates managed entirely by Oracle NetSuite ensure the system is always current. | Coordinated updates across modules offer flexibility but may require additional IT oversight. |
Maintenance Approach | Centralized maintenance simplifies troubleshooting and minimizes the risk of version conflicts. | In-house management of customizations may be necessary, potentially increasing IT resource demands. |
Final Thought: Companies that prefer a hands-off approach to ERP maintenance may benefit from NetSuite’s fully managed cloud solution, while organizations with a strong internal IT team may appreciate the control and flexibility offered by Dynamics 365’s hybrid deployment options.
ERP implementations also involve improving finance, operations, customer engagement, and decision-making. NetSuite and Microsoft Dynamics 365 approach these core business functions differently, which can significantly affect how organizations scale and streamline their operations. Below is a detailed breakdown of how each system handles essential business functions.
Financial management is at the heart of every ERP system. It ensures that companies can efficiently track revenue, control costs, manage compliance, and forecast financial trends.
Aspect | NetSuite | Dynamics 365 |
---|---|---|
Reporting | Offers real-time financial reporting with dynamic dashboards, giving CFOs and finance teams up-to-date visibility into cash flow, expenses, and profitability. | Advanced financial modules provide detailed compliance reporting and cost accounting, particularly useful for highly regulated industries. |
Accounting | Built-in general ledger, accounts payable, and accounts receivable modules integrate seamlessly, reducing manual reconciliations and errors. | Supports complex financial scenarios, including intercompany transactions, tax compliance, and multi-entity consolidations. |
Forecasting | Uses historical data to provide automated revenue, expense, and cash flow forecasting, helping businesses plan for future growth. | Scenario-based financial modeling enables companies to compare multiple financial projections and assess potential outcomes. |
Key Insight: If your organization needs a turnkey financial system with minimal manual configuration, NetSuite’s built-in accounting automation may be the better choice. However, if you require granular financial analysis and forecasting, Dynamics 365’s scenario-based financial modeling provides deeper insights for CFOs.
Effective supply chain management ensures that products are available where and when they are needed, minimizing disruptions and optimizing inventory levels.
Aspect | NetSuite | Dynamics 365 |
---|---|---|
Inventory Control | Provides real-time stock tracking, warehouse visibility, and demand planning tools to prevent stockouts or overstocking. | Uses dynamic inventory management, adjusting stock levels based on sales trends, supplier performance, and demand fluctuations. |
Logistics | End-to-end order-to-delivery tracking, integrating with shipping carriers to streamline fulfillment processes. | Supports multi-echelon inventory models, making it ideal for companies with complex supply chains involving multiple warehouses or global distribution. |
Demand Planning | AI-driven demand forecasting uses historical sales data to optimize purchasing and reduce excess inventory costs. | Advanced procurement and supplier management tools help organizations analyze vendor performance and negotiate better contracts. |
Key Insight: NetSuite is ideal for e-commerce, wholesale, and distribution companies that need real-time inventory tracking. Dynamics 365, on the other hand, excels in complex supply chains with multi-tier logistics, making it a great fit for manufacturers and enterprises managing multiple warehouses.
CRM capabilities help companies nurture leads, track customer touchpoints, and ensure high satisfaction levels. This area often ties directly into revenue growth and brand reputation.
Aspect | NetSuite | Dynamics 365 |
---|---|---|
Customer Data | Unifies sales, marketing, and customer service data in one platform for a 360-degree customer view. | Dedicated Sales, Marketing, and Customer Service modules provide highly specialized tools for different business needs. |
Automation | Automates lead tracking, sales pipeline management, and customer follow-ups, streamlining sales operations. | Leverages AI-driven insights to identify high-value prospects, automate sales tasks, and personalize marketing campaigns. |
Service Tools | Features case management, support ticket tracking, and SLA management, improving customer service response times. | Natively integrates with Microsoft Outlook and Teams, allowing seamless communication between sales teams and customers. |
Key Insight: NetSuite provides a fully integrated CRM within the ERP, making it easier to track customer interactions across multiple business functions. Dynamics 365 offers specialized CRM modules with AI-powered insights, making it a stronger choice for businesses that require advanced sales automation and customer engagement tools.
Data-driven decisions can keep a business on track, from daily operations to long-term strategy. Having robust reporting tools in your ERP reduces guesswork and helps managers spot patterns.
Aspect | NetSuite | Dynamics 365 |
---|---|---|
Dashboards | SuiteAnalytics provides custom dashboards with KPI monitoring, allowing real-time visibility into business performance. | Power BI transforms raw data into interactive, visual dashboards with predictive analytics. |
Reporting | Customizable real-time financial and operational reports enable quick data-driven decision-making. | AI-powered insights provide deep data analysis, offering recommendations for business improvement. |
Analytical Tools | Includes built-in trend analysis and visualization tools to simplify complex financial and operational data. | Supports predictive analytics, machine learning, and real-time scenario analysis. |
Key Insight: NetSuite's SuiteAnalytics will benefit businesses looking for real-time visibility and pre-configured reporting. Companies that need advanced AI-powered business intelligence and customizable reports will find Dynamics 365’s Power BI integration more valuable.
For multinational organizations, ERP systems must handle multi-currency transactions, regulatory compliance, and localization requirements.
Aspect | NetSuite | Dynamics 365 |
---|---|---|
Multi-Currency | Automatic currency conversion and tax adjustments simplify international transactions. | Multi-currency features support global financial consolidation and reporting. |
Localization | Supports multiple languages and country-specific tax laws out-of-the-box. | Country-specific regulatory compliance tools help companies meet international standards. |
Scalable Infrastructure | Designed for fast global expansion without complex reconfiguration. | Flexible cloud and on-premises options allow businesses to store data in specific regions for compliance. |
Key Insight: NetSuite is built for rapid international expansion, making it ideal for companies looking to scale globally without major configuration changes. Dynamics 365’s flexible deployment models allow businesses to store and manage data in compliance with local regulations, which may be preferable for companies in highly regulated industries.
Understanding the advantages and potential drawbacks of each ERP system is essential in determining which one best aligns with your business goals, IT capabilities, and long-term strategy. We break down the key benefits and challenges of NetSuite and Microsoft Dynamics 365 to help you make an informed decision.
Choosing the right ERP system requires a clear understanding of how each platform fits into your business structure, technology stack, and future growth plans. While NetSuite and Microsoft Dynamics 365 both offer enterprise-level solutions for financial management, customer relationships, and operations, they take different approaches in areas like customization, deployment, and scalability.
Here’s how they compare:
Feature/Factor | NetSuite ERP | Microsoft Dynamics 365 |
---|---|---|
Deployment Model | Cloud-based, fully managed by NetSuite with automatic updates and maintenance. | Cloud-based, hybrid, or on-premises, allowing businesses to maintain on-site control if needed. |
Customization Options | Uses SuiteScript and SuiteFlow for workflow automation, making configurations easier without deep coding. | Highly modular, with custom options available through Power Platform and Power Automate for more complex adjustments. |
Financial Management | Strong multi-currency and multi-entity support, automated tax compliance, and real-time financial reporting. | Advanced cost accounting, scenario modeling, and compliance tools, well-suited for organizations with layered financial structures. |
CRM Features | Built-in CRM that integrates seamlessly with financial and operational data for a unified customer view. | Dedicated CRM modules designed for sales, marketing, and customer service, with AI-powered insights. |
Integration Capabilities | Comprehensive API support, direct e-commerce integrations with platforms like Shopify, Magento, and Amazon. | Seamless Microsoft integration, designed to work effortlessly with Office 365, SharePoint, and Azure. |
Scalability | Designed for mid-sized and growing enterprises, with built-in global support for multi-entity management. | Modular structure allows businesses to scale individual components instead of expanding the entire system at once. |
Both NetSuite and Microsoft Dynamics 365 offer powerful ERP functionalities, but the best choice depends on your company’s specific needs.
Choose NetSuite If:
Choose Microsoft Dynamics 365 If:
Microsoft Dynamics 365 and NetSuite deliver multi-currency support, robust security, and global operational capabilities. However, the ideal choice depends on specific factors like manufacturing complexity, the importance of Microsoft integrations, and the role of advanced analytics in daily decision-making. The total cost of ownership also varies, especially when considering licensing structures, potential customizations, and necessary training to ensure user adoption. Centium holds a proven record of helping businesses select and implement NetSuite to maximize efficiency and ROI. Our team focuses on strategic planning, seamless system integration, and ongoing optimization to align ERP capabilities with corporate objectives. Reach out today for personalized guidance on how NetSuite solutions can strengthen your operations, support expansion, and facilitate better-informed decisions for your organization's future.
NetSuite’s modular ERP system is one of its greatest strengths—but it’s also one of the easiest places for businesses to overspend.
At Centium, we specialize in helping businesses leverage the power of NetSuite to streamline financial operations and drive growth. As a leading...
Navigating the world of Oracle NetSuite can feel like decoding a complex puzzle, especially when it comes to understanding the NetSuite price, user...